The meaning of Bellissimo

beautiful Is the absolute highest Bello, A masculine adjective, can be translated into many ways, including beautiful, Hansome, OK, charming, and beautiful Just to name a few. It is used to describe male or masculine nouns.suffix -issimo It just strengthens the meaning of adjectives, much like English adverbs Very.

Plural form

If you are talking about more than one person or one thing, very beautiful / beautiful Becomes plural beautiful / beautiful respectively.
